Transaction 6faacab2661efbdd99e1a095546040b6abf8e1d8bdfac74e16744ceb7fa0f0e2
1 Input
1 Output
-
6faacab2661efbdd99e1a095546040b6abf8e1d8bdfac74e16744ceb7fa0f0e2:0
- value
- 39459
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 163570cfb9808709ac962e6cefb27e2ef805e83c OP_EQUAL
- address
- 33iSotPbaaTLMFHK17rgKrLNU5hiBHZxMU